> On 8/25/21 10:08 AM, chunming wrote:
> > From: chunming <chunming.li@verisilicon.com>
> >
> > Replace "smmuv3_flush_config" with "g_hash_table_foreach_remove".
> this replacement may have a potential negative impact on the
> performance
> for PCIe support, which is the main use case: a unique
> g_hash_table_remove() is replaced by an iteration over all the config
> hash keys.
> 
> I wonder if you couldn't just adapt smmu_iommu_mr() and it case this
> latter returns NULL for the current PCIe search, look up in the
> platform
> device list:
> 
> peri_sdev_list?

I think there are 2 scenes:
        1.  PCIe devices share same SID with peripheral devices.
      2.  Multi peripheral devices share same SID.
If we search PCIe 1st then search peri_sdev_list, there are 2 problems:
      1.  The code is complex.
      2.  We may need to search peri_sdev_list multi times. It may has 
performance impact.
        
The CFGI commands are only called when the SMMU device is removed.
So we think there is no big performance impact.
